Yes, He had it painted Black in the 80's then restored to its Orig hue.

His Family drove the Car to the PNW from Conn. in the late 60's as his father left Electric Boat for Puget sound Naval shipyard (*Work)

Fred Cruzed the Car & is thankful they saved the car all those years, Storage was hard on it but He got it Done.

Options.

Custom Sports Steering Wheel.
Check out those 3 pedals. Looks like a possible tilt column.
First design or maybe a Cal Custom or other 60’s type accessories for the photo shoot.

1965 Rally Wheel with the correct full polished stainless center dish with the black painted ring on the chrome cone, one year only.

A set of NOS splitters in storage.
